Cardiovascular Technologist

Healthcare AI-Augmented

Assists physicians in diagnosing and treating heart and blood vessel ailments.

Salary Growth

Starting
$58,000
Year 5
$78,000
Year 10
$98,000
Top Earners
$130,000
Promotion Path: Technologist -> Senior Technologist -> Department Manager.

AI Impact & Task Breakdown

AI-Augmented

AI assists in real-time image analysis and arrhythmia detection.
